Comparative law notes

Brazil

"Vício redibitório" is a hidden defect that renders the goods improper for the use they were made for, or that reduces their value (sec. 441 et seq. of the Brazilian Civil Code)". As opposed to a latent defect, a "vício redibitório" is a defect that the seller or service provider does not necessarily know about in advance.

Definitions of latent defect

English

a fault that is hidden, that the seller or service provider knows about, and that cannot be easily discovered by close examination

If you are selling a house, and know of a latent defect, you should seek legal advice to avoid liability down the road.
